/**************************************************************************
AVStream Simulated Hardware Sample
Copyright (c) 2001, Microsoft Corporation.
File:
avshws.h
Abstract:
AVStream Simulated Hardware Sample header file. This is the
main header.
History:
created 3/12/2001
**************************************************************************/
/*************************************************
Standard Includes
*************************************************/
#ifndef _avshws_h_
#define _avshws_h_
extern "C" {
#include <wdm.h>
}
#include <windef.h>
#include <stdio.h>
#include <ntstrsafe.h>
#include <stdlib.h>
#include <windef.h>
#define NOBITMAP
#include <mmreg.h>
#undef NOBITMAP
#include <unknown.h>
#include <ks.h>
#include <ksmedia.h>
/*************************************************
Misc Definitions
*************************************************/
#pragma warning (disable : 4100 4127 4131 4189 4701 4706)
#define STR_MODULENAME "avshws: "
#define DEBUGLVL_VERBOSE 2
#define DEBUGLVL_TERSE 1
#define DEBUGLVL_ERROR 0
const DebugLevel = DEBUGLVL_TERSE;
#if (DBG)
#define _DbgPrintF(lvl, strings) \
{ \
if (lvl <= DebugLevel) {\
DbgPrint(STR_MODULENAME);\
DbgPrint##strings;\
DbgPrint("\n");\
if ((lvl) == DEBUGLVL_ERROR) {\
NT_ASSERT(0);\
} \
}\
}
#else // !DBG
#define _DbgPrintF(lvl, strings)
#endif // !DBG
#define ABS(x) ((x) < 0 ? (-(x)) : (x))
#ifndef mmioFOURCC
#define mmioFOURCC( ch0, ch1, ch2, ch3 ) \
( (DWORD)(BYTE)(ch0) | ( (DWORD)(BYTE)(ch1) << 8 ) | \
( (DWORD)(BYTE)(ch2) << 16 ) | ( (DWORD)(BYTE)(ch3) << 24 ) )
#endif
#define FOURCC_YUY2 mmioFOURCC('Y', 'U', 'Y', '2')
//
// CAPTURE_PIN_DATA_RANGE_COUNT:
//
// The number of ranges supported on the capture pin.
//
#define CAPTURE_PIN_DATA_RANGE_COUNT 2
//
// CAPTURE_FILTER_PIN_COUNT:
//
// The number of pins on the capture filter.
//
#define CAPTURE_FILTER_PIN_COUNT 1
//
// CAPTURE_FILTER_CATEGORIES_COUNT:
//
// The number of categories for the capture filter.
//
#define CAPTURE_FILTER_CATEGORIES_COUNT 3
#define AVSHWS_POOLTAG 'hSVA'
/*************************************************
Externed information
*************************************************/
//
// filter.cpp externs:
//
extern
const
KSFILTER_DISPATCH
CaptureFilterDispatch;
extern
const
KSFILTER_DESCRIPTOR
CaptureFilterDescriptor;
extern
const
KSPIN_DESCRIPTOR_EX
CaptureFilterPinDescriptors [CAPTURE_FILTER_PIN_COUNT];
extern
const
GUID
CaptureFilterCategories [CAPTURE_FILTER_CATEGORIES_COUNT];
//
// capture.cpp externs:
//
extern
const
KSALLOCATOR_FRAMING_EX
CapturePinAllocatorFraming;
extern
const
KSPIN_DISPATCH
CapturePinDispatch;
extern
const
PKSDATARANGE
CapturePinDataRanges [CAPTURE_PIN_DATA_RANGE_COUNT];
/*************************************************
Enums / Typedefs
*************************************************/
typedef enum _HARDWARE_STATE {
HardwareStopped = 0,
HardwarePaused,
HardwareRunning
} HARDWARE_STATE, *PHARDWARE_STATE;
/*************************************************
Class Definitions
*************************************************/
//
// IHardwareSink:
//
// This interface is used by the hardware simulation to fake interrupt
// service routines. The Interrupt method is called at DPC as a fake
// interrupt.
//
class IHardwareSink {
public:
virtual
void
Interrupt (
) = 0;
};
//
// ICaptureSink:
//
// This is a capture sink interface. The device level calls back the
// CompleteMappings method passing the number of completed mappings for
// the capture pin. This method is called during the device DPC.
//
class ICaptureSink {
public:
virtual
void
CompleteMappings (
IN ULONG NumMappings
) = 0;
};
/*************************************************
Global Functions
*************************************************/
#ifndef _NEW_DELETE_OPERATORS_
#define _NEW_DELETE_OPERATORS_
/*************************************************
Add definitions that are missing for C++14.
*************************************************/
PVOID operator new
(
size_t iSize,
_When_((poolType & NonPagedPoolMustSucceed) != 0,
__drv_reportError("Must succeed pool allocations are forbidden. "
"Allocation failures cause a system crash"))
POOL_TYPE poolType
);
PVOID operator new
(
size_t iSize,
_When_((poolType & NonPagedPoolMustSucceed) != 0,
__drv_reportError("Must succeed pool allocations are forbidden. "
"Allocation failures cause a system crash"))
POOL_TYPE poolType,
ULONG tag
);
/*++
Routine Description:
Array new() operator for creating objects with a specified allocation tag.
Arguments:
iSize -
The size of the entire allocation.
poolType -
The type of allocation. Ex: PagedPool or NonPagedPoolNx
tag -
A 4-byte allocation identifier.
Return Value:
None
--*/
PVOID
operator new[](
size_t iSize,
_When_((poolType & NonPagedPoolMustSucceed) != 0,
__drv_reportError("Must succeed pool allocations are forbidden. "
"Allocation failures cause a system crash"))
POOL_TYPE poolType,
ULONG tag
);
/*++
Routine Description:
Array delete() operator.
Arguments:
pVoid -
The memory to free.
Return Value:
None
--*/
void
__cdecl
operator delete[](
PVOID pVoid
);
/*++
Routine Description:
Sized delete() operator.
Arguments:
pVoid -
The memory to free.
size -
The size of the memory to free.
Return Value:
None
--*/
void __cdecl operator delete
(
void *pVoid,
size_t /*size*/
);
/*++
Routine Description:
Sized delete[]() operator.
Arguments:
pVoid -
The memory to free.
size -
The size of the memory to free.
Return Value:
None
--*/
void __cdecl operator delete[]
(
void *pVoid,
size_t /*size*/
);
#endif // _NEW_DELETE_OPERATORS_
/*************************************************
Internal Includes
*************************************************/
#include "image.h"
#include "hwsim.h"
#include "device.h"
#include "filter.h"
#include "capture.h"
#include <uuids.h>
#endif //_avshws_h_
